Reasons for Undelivered Packages
There are many reasons that a package may be returned to us as undeliverable.
- Item is too big for a P.O. Box.
Some items are too big to ship to a P.O. Box and must be shipped to a street address.
- Incorrect Address.
If the address is incorrect or outdated, the package is typically returned to us by the carrier or the unintended recipient.
- Carrier Does Not Deliver to the Address.
The U.S. Postal Service does not deliver to some addresses. If you also have a PO Box address, it's best to use that address for your orders. All orders with "PO BOX" in the address are automatically shipped via U.S. Mail.
- Address Format.
If a post office box address was entered in a format our system does not recognize, the package may be shipped through a carrier that cannot deliver to a post office box. To ensure that such packages are routed through the proper carriers, please enter the box number as "PO BOX" followed by the number. Also, if you're a private mailbox holder (use a local commercial mail receiving agency), do not use "Box" for your mailbox number, instead use # or PMB. This will ensure that your address is not mistaken to be a P.O. Box, and that orders can ship to you via means other than the U.S. Postal Service.
- Other Address Problems.
If the order is being shipped to a prison, there may be delivery restrictions associated with the items or shippers. These restrictions are determined by the penitentiary and may vary. For more information about shipping to prisons.
- Failed Delivery Attempts.
Most of our carriers make three attempts to deliver a package. Packages that contain more than $500 of merchandise will always require a signature; otherwise, it is generally up to the driver's discretion to determine whether a signature is required. After three attempts, the package will be returned to us.
- Damaged During Transit.
If a package is damaged on its way to you, the shipper may return it to us without attempting delivery.
- Refused by Recipient.
If a recipient is not expecting a package, they may refuse it if they believe it was sent to them in error.
